A few of us at work have started using Microsoft One Note.  All I can say is so far it is the best collaboration software I have used.  Near real time changes.  You can be working on a document in a tab and you can see the changes that someone else from the team is making as their One Note syncs with yours.  You can add files, pictures, documents, etc to the page while adding notes to the page.  We now use it for projects and meeting notes.  One thing I really like is I can go offline and then once I am back online it syncs all the changes I made and any change other people have made.  You then can also have a personal notebook to keep your work seperate.  You can password protect areas or notebooks also.  Who knew I would like a Mirosoft product so much?
